Abstract:
PURPOSE: The aim of this study was to investigate matrix metalloproteinase 1 (MMP-1) gene polymorphism (1G/2G at -1607 and A/G at -519) in Korean subject and to assess the association between polymorphism and periodontal status. METHODS: Forty nine generalized aggressive periodontitis (GAP) patients and 57 periodontally healthy children were recruited and genomic DNA was extracted from buccal swab. The polymorphisms of MMP-1 promoter genes were determined by polymerase chain reaction and restriction fragment length product (PCR-RFLP) method. The distribution of genotype and allele frequency was compared between 2 groups by chi-square test. RESULTS: There was a significant difference in the distribution of genotypes and frequency of alleles between the GAP and reference groups at the position - 519 of MMP-1 gene promoter (P< 0.05). Allele G carrier rate was significantly lower in GAP group than that of the reference group (P< 0.001). At the position -1607 of MMP-1 gene promoter, genotype distribution and allele frequency showed no statistically significant difference between the groups. However, in the female group, a significant difference was observed between the groups for the genotype distribution, allele frequency and allele 1G carrier rate (P< 0.05). CONCLUSIONS: The DNA polymorphism at the MMP-1 gene promoter might be associated with GAP in Korean.
